Ali MacGraw
Elizabeth Alice MacGraw better known as Ali MacGraw is an award-winning American actress, model, writer and activist for animal rights. Love Story (1970), Goodbye Columbus '69 and The Getaway 72 are among her most well-known films. In New York, she was born into an creative family. She started as a photographer's assistant, and later moved into acting and modeling. She received the Golden Globe Award, for the most promising young talent. MacGraw's 1970 film Love Story proved a major smash and brought her world fame and an Academy Award' nomination and an Academy Award nomination and a Golden Globe award. With just three releases MacGraw was named the top female box-office start in the world. In 1972, the Grauman's Chinese Theater engraved her autograph, hand-prints and foot prints in the year 1972. The other films she has appeared on comprise The Getaway Convoy Players, the miniseries on TV The Winds of War and other. Moving Pictures, her 1991 autobiography was published. MacGraw's been married three different times.
